
( Brand: Atmel ), ( Manufacturer Part Number: STK-500 ), ( Country/region Of Manufacture: United States )
The STK-500 Atmel Development Platform Programmer from Microchip is a comprehensive tool designed for developers and hobbyists working with Atmel microcontrollers. This programmer offers an easy-to-use interface for programming, debugging, and testing Atmel AVR and XMEGA microcontrollers.
The STK-500 features a dual-channel ISP/JTAG interface, enabling simultaneous programming and debugging of two microcontrollers. It supports a wide range of Atmel devices, including AVR, XMEGA, and Xplained PRO boards, making it a versatile tool for various development projects.
The programmer comes with a user-friendly software, Microchip's Atmel Studio, which allows for easy programming and debugging. The software provides a graphical user interface, making it simple for beginners to navigate, while also offering advanced features for experienced developers.
The STK-500 Atmel Development Platform Programmer is also equipped with a built-in oscilloscope, allowing for real-time signal analysis and debugging. This feature can help identify and resolve complex issues, saving time and effort in the development process.
In addition, the programmer includes a power supply, allowing it to power the microcontroller during programming and debugging. This eliminates the need for an external power source, making the STK-500 a self-contained development platform.
The STK-500 Atmel Development Platform Programmer from Microchip is a must-have tool for any developer working with Atmel microcontrollers. Its dual-channel ISP/JTAG interface, wide device support, built-in oscilloscope, and self-contained power supply make it a powerful and versatile development tool. Furthermore, its easy-to-use software and user-friendly interface make it accessible to developers of all skill levels.
Pros of buying STK-500 Atmel Development Platform Programmer (Microchip UN-Brick):1. Compatibility: The STK-500 is compatible with a wide range of Atmel microcontrollers, making it a versatile tool for developers.
2. Convenience: It comes with several on-board peripherals and interfaces, reducing the need for additional components.
3. Easy to Use: The software interface is user-friendly, making programming and debugging easier for beginners.
4. Durable: The STK-500 is a solid, well-built device, ensuring it can withstand regular use.
5. Un-brick Functionality: The Microchip UN-Brick feature allows you to recover a bricked microcontroller, saving you from having to replace it.
Cons of buying STK-500 Atmel Development Platform Programmer (Microchip UN-Brick):1. Price: The STK-500 is relatively expensive compared to other programmers, which may be a deterrent for some developers.
2. Limited to Atmel: While the STK-500 is compatible with a wide range of Atmel microcontrollers, it is not compatible with other microcontroller families, limiting its use to Atmel-based projects.
3. Size: The STK-500 is a large device, taking up significant space on your workbench.
Conclusion:The STK-500 Atmel Development Platform Programmer with Microchip UN-Brick is a high-quality tool for developers who work with Atmel microcontrollers. Its ease of use, durability, and versatility make it a valuable investment for those who frequently work with these microcontrollers. However, its high price and limited compatibility with other microcontroller families may be a drawback for some developers.
Recommendation:If you frequently work with Atmel microcontrollers and are looking for a reliable, easy-to-use development platform, the STK-500 with Microchip UN-Brick is a recommended choice. However, if you work with a variety of microcontrollers or are looking for a more budget-friendly option, you may want to consider other programmers that offer more flexibility and affordability.
Optional expansion cards are available for the different Ave sub-families and larger devices, but not needed more popular 40-pin, 28-pin, 20-pin, 8-pin devices. The kit interfaces with Ave studio, Atmel integrated development environment IDE for code writing and debugging.
The Ave studio online-help contains most current information and a complete list of supported devices this board supports them directly. It is always a good idea to have the ISP pads available on your embedded design for updating or programming you firmware without need remove part. This programmer can also be used to 'un-brick' Arduino chips that have been put into a state where they are no longer recognized by the IDE.
These development programming boards are 100 functional.